I am a clinical psychologist with experience working with children, teenagers, and adults in the Middle East region. I obtained my bachelor’s and master’s degrees from American University of Beirut. I am licensed to practice clinical psychology in Lebanon and Dubai, and I speak English and Arabic.
My specialty includes psychotherapy and psychoeducational assessments. I provide psychotherapy to children (9+ years), adolescents and adults to address various difficulties (e.g., worries, sadness, stress, anxiety disorders, depression, ADHD etc.). I utilize client-centered approach and incorporate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Interpersonal Therapy techniques. I also provide parent management training, where I work with parents to help them support their children’s behavioral and emotional needs. I also provide assessments to children and adolescents struggling with educational, cognitive, behavioral andor emotional difficulties.
